A lithium battery energy storage system uses lithium-ion batteries to store electrical energy for later use. These batteries are designed to store and release energy efficiently, making them an excellent choice for various applications, from powering everyday devices to supporting large-scale.

A lithium-ion battery energy storage system is an electrochemical device that charges or collects energy from the grid or a power plant and then discharges that energy later to provide electricity or other grid services when needed.
